Why Business Moves Are Different from Residential Moving

Many people assume that moving a business is just like residential moving, but there are crucial differences.

  • Complexity of Items: Offices contain electronics, computers, servers, and specialized furniture that require careful handling. Residential moves typically involve personal belongings that, while valuable, are less sensitive to mishandling.

  • Downtime Sensitivity: Every day of business disruption can lead to lost revenue or decreased productivity. Residential moves don’t carry the same economic consequences.

  • Coordination: Office moves require detailed planning for IT setup, security systems, and employee workstations, which is less of a concern in home relocations.

Because of these factors, businesses benefit greatly from professional commercial moving services that understand the logistics and demands of a corporate environment.

Step 1: Planning and Consultation

One of the first steps in a successful office move is thorough planning. Commercial moving services provide consultation to assess the scope of the move, identify potential challenges, and develop a detailed schedule.

This stage includes:

  • Understanding your office layout and workflow

  • Identifying sensitive or high-value equipment

  • Coordinating move dates to minimize operational impact

A well-thought-out plan reduces surprises on moving day and keeps the process on track. Experienced commercial movers also provide insights on best practices, such as phased relocations or after-hours moves, to ensure continuity of business operations.

Step 2: Inventory and Organization

Unlike residential moving, office relocations involve large quantities of equipment and documents that must be tracked carefully. Commercial movers use organized labeling, inventory tracking, and color-coded systems to ensure nothing is lost or misplaced.

From filing cabinets and office furniture to computers and servers, each item is documented before leaving the premises. This attention to detail ensures accountability and makes it easier to set up the new workspace efficiently.

Step 3: Specialized Packing for Sensitive Items

Office equipment, electronics, and important documents require careful handling. Commercial movers bring the right materials and techniques to protect these items during transit.

For example, servers and computers are packed with anti-static materials, heavy office furniture is disassembled and padded, and fragile items such as monitors and glass tables are handled with specialized crates. This level of care reduces the risk of damage and provides peace of mind to business owners.

Step 4: Secure and Efficient Transport

Transportation is often the most challenging part of a move. Commercial movers use climate-controlled trucks for sensitive electronics and secure transport methods for valuable items.

Experienced drivers are trained to navigate traffic, narrow streets, and loading docks safely. Additionally, companies may use GPS tracking to monitor the move in real-time, ensuring items arrive on schedule and in perfect condition.

By relying on professionals, businesses can avoid the pitfalls of DIY moving, such as lost equipment, damaged goods, or delays.

Step 5: Placement and Setup at the New Location

Once items arrive, commercial movers don’t simply unload and leave. They place furniture and equipment exactly where it needs to go, following a pre-planned layout.

Many Toronto businesses rely on commercial movers to:

  • Assemble desks and office furniture

  • Set up IT equipment and cabling

  • Arrange common areas and meeting rooms

  • Dispose of packaging and debris

This step is critical for minimizing downtime. Employees can resume work quickly because the office is functional and organized immediately after the move.

High-Rise Office Relocations in Toronto

Toronto’s commercial landscape includes numerous high-rise office buildings, which present unique challenges. Moving equipment and furniture in and out of these buildings requires careful coordination with building management, elevators, and security procedures.

Commercial movers are well-versed in these challenges and have the expertise to navigate high-rise logistics efficiently. Their experience ensures a smooth move even in the most complex urban environments.
